Zero-knowledge proof blockchain, esența este o frază: fără a dezvălui secretul tău, poți dovedi că nu ai mințit. Folosește logică matematică pentru a permite blockchain-ului să funcționeze în mod sigur și eficient, fără a dezvălui datele și fără a pierde dreptul de proprietate asupra activelor.

Blockchain-urile publice tradiționale sunt ca un "carnet de conturi complet transparent", toată lumea poate vedea soldul tău, persoanele către care transferi și sumele. Pentru a valida legalitatea unei tranzacții, trebuie să publici toate informațiile, iar confidențialitatea nu poate fi garantată. Însă blockchain-ul cu zero-knowledge proof nu necesită dezvăluirea datelor originale, ci trebuie doar să prezinți un **"dovadă"**, pentru a-i face pe toți nodurile din rețea să creadă: această tranzacție este reală, activele sunt ale tale, nu există dublă cheltuire, nu există încălcări.

Logica de bază a funcționării sale poate fi împărțită simplu în trei pași: dovadă, verificare, actualizare.

Primul pas, generarea locală a dovezilor. Atunci când inițiezi o tranziție, sistemul nu va difuza direct soldul tău, adresa celeilalte părți și suma, ci va împacheta aceste informații într-o dovadă matematică scurtă pe dispozitivul tău folosind un algoritm de cunoștințe zero. Această dovadă arată doar trei lucruri: am suficienți bani, această tranzacție respectă regulile, iar dreptul de proprietate asupra activelor îmi aparține. În afară de asta, nu se dezvăluie niciun date de confidențialitate, nimeni nu poate deduce informațiile tale reale.

Pasul doi, verificare rapidă pe lanț. Nodurile blockchain primesc dovada și nu trebuie să știe datele tale reale, ci doar folosesc un set fix de algoritmi simpli pentru a determina dacă dovada este validă. Acest proces este foarte rapid, fără calcule complexe și fără a decripta datele. Atâta timp cât dovada trece, tranzacția este considerată legală. Aceasta este și cauza pentru care lanțul ZK are o viteză mare și o capacitate de procesare ridicată.

Pasul trei, actualizarea stării criptate. Toate conturile și activele de pe lanț sunt stocate sub formă criptată, fără a se vedea conținutul real. După ce verificarea este completă, sistemul actualizează direct starea criptată, fără a expune datele în clar. Nodurile, fără a cunoaște informațiile specifice, pot atinge în continuare un consens și pot menține securitatea blockchain-ului.

Cele trei caracteristici principale ale dovezilor cu cunoștințe zero garantează că această logică poate funcționa: unu, dacă este adevărat, poate trece, atâta timp cât tranzacția este legală, dovada este întotdeauna validă; doi, dacă este fals, nu poate trece, nimeni nu poate falsifica dovezi pentru a înșela; trei, în afară de rezultat, nu se vede nimic, după verificare se știe doar "tranzacția este validă", fără a ști nimic despre conținuturile confidențiale.

Spre deosebire de soluțiile tradiționale de confidențialitate, blockchain-ul ZK nu se bazează pe ascunderea sau confuzia informațiilor, ci pe garanția matematică a securității. Acesta rezolvă atât problema transparenței publicului fără confidențialitate, cât și problema eficienței scăzute și a dificultății de verificare a lanțurilor de confidențialitate. În timp ce protejează datele și drepturile de proprietate, poate îmbunătăți și viteza tranzacțiilor, reducând comisioanele.

Rezumat simplu: logica de bază a blockchain-ului cu dovezi cu cunoștințe zero este de a folosi "dovada" în loc de "publicarea informațiilor". Aceasta transformă blockchain-ul din "complet transparent" în "de încredere, dar confidențial", realizând într-adevăr protecția confidențialității fără a compromite securitatea, dreptul de proprietate și eficiența, permițând utilizarea blockchain-ului în domenii reale precum finanțele, identitatea, securitatea datelor etc.